What's Happening?
The hospitality industry faces a dilemma as AI technologies rapidly evolve. Hotels are grappling with whether to adopt AI solutions now or wait for the technology to mature. The industry has historically hesitated with new technologies, often allowing online travel agencies (OTAs) to dominate. The current AI landscape is volatile, with no established standards, making it challenging for hotels to decide on investments. The article suggests a cautious approach, encouraging hotels to experiment with AI in a controlled environment to gain experience and prepare for future advancements.
Why It's Important?
The decision to adopt AI technologies is critical for the hospitality industry, which must balance innovation with risk management. As AI continues to transform business
operations, hotels that delay adoption risk falling behind competitors and missing out on potential efficiencies and customer engagement opportunities. By experimenting with AI in a controlled setting, hotels can better understand its capabilities and limitations, positioning themselves to capitalize on future advancements. This approach allows hotels to innovate without overcommitting resources, ensuring they remain competitive in a rapidly changing market.
What's Next?
Hotels are encouraged to establish small-scale AI projects to explore potential applications and build internal expertise. This approach allows for experimentation and learning without significant financial risk. As AI technologies continue to develop, hotels that have gained experience through these projects will be better positioned to integrate new solutions and adapt to industry changes. Collaboration with technology partners and industry peers will be essential to navigate the evolving AI landscape and ensure successful implementation.
